For a prospective freeware app, I've been attempting to get the Win32 native TreeView widget to work. The current phobos std.c.windows.windows.d only includes support for the basic widgets (buttons, text fields, checkboxes, etc.)

I started with winsamp.d, and "cloned" std.c.windows.windows.d to windows_tree.d. This file defines the constants and structures to make calls to the Win32 api for creating and handling the native TreeView control.

Eureka, it is starting to actually work ...

Except ... for me but not everyone. Sigh.

Another person is having problems getting winsamp3.exe to run. JCC experiences the error message noting that the "ChapSelectorTree was not created" which indicates that the call to std.c.windows.windows.CreateWindowA failed.

winsamp3.exe is a 75kb file that should be self-contained except for calls to msvcrt.dll and gui32.dll. It runs fine on three of my home computers, including Xp-Home and Win2000 (one of which is a test computer with not much beyond a baseline installation).

> Another person is having problems getting winsamp3.exe to run. JCC
> experiences the error message noting that the "ChapSelectorTree was not
> created" which indicates that the call to
> std.c.windows.windows.CreateWindowA failed.

I think I discovered the problem:
InitCommonControls() should be called.
